There is no clear definition as to what Internet of Things really is. But here is the zeast as to what it seems to be shaping up to. Under Internet of Things (IoT), objects, animals and people have a unique identifier and everybody can be captured onto a smart grid.
It is easy to understand the Internet of Things by a practical example. In 1982, a Coke machine was modified to be connected to the Internet at the Carnegie Mellon University. The machine was able to report the inventory, and also whether the Coke bottles in the machine were at a cool enough temperature. This was actually the first appliance to be connected to the Internet.
The Internet of Things is touted to be the next big thing. Why is this so? Take any screen based device – whether it is your TV or your phone or your laptop – and notice the technological developments in recent times.

Source
The evolution of ground-breaking innovations has reached close. Sure, there are new features in the form of retina displays, 3D, cameras etc. but they don’t actually further the basic functionality of these devices, even though in themselves they may be amazing developments.They are what may be called add on features. Thus evolution of such screen based devices has almost come to a standstill. The next big thing that takes all such devices to the next level is Internet of Things.
Today device innovation is limited to the things that we call ‘devices’, today. For example you would call a phone a device but you would not call a book a device. The Internet of Things envisions the developments made in device design and chip design to apply to normal everyday objects, something as small as a packet of baby diapers.
